Mohsen Haidary

Owner
Head Coach - Wrestling & MMA

"Life is like an echo—what you send out always comes back to you."  — Mohsen H.

With over 32 years of experience in Freestyle and Greco-Roman wrestling, Coach Mohsen brings a remarkable depth of expertise to the mat. Wrestling runs in his blood, passed down through generations—from his father and grandfather, both seasoned wrestlers. He was learning moves before he could speak, beginning serious training at just 11 years old. He has competed around the world as a member of the Iranian National Junior and Army Senior Teams, earning an impressive collection of accolades: 8 gold, 6 silver, and 2 bronze medals on the international stage. For the past 12 years, he has been a prominent figure in Australian wrestling, respected not only for his technical mastery but also for his sportsmanship and unwavering passion for growing the sport.

In addition to his wrestling pedigree, Mohsen holds a brown belt in Judo and has trained in Sambo, Boxing, and since relocating to Australia, he began training in Jiu-Jitsu. He is currently developing his striking skills through Muay Thai. This diverse martial arts foundation—combined with his expertise in strength and conditioning, elite athlete development, and high-performance nutrition—naturally led him into MMA coaching. As an MMA coach, Mohsen integrates wrestling fundamentals with striking and submission techniques, tailoring programs to help fighters maximize their strengths, overcome weaknesses, and succeed at every level—from amateur debuts to international competition.
